This position is for a Material & Process Engineer 2 with responsibilities in nonmetallic materials and processes. Assignments to include, but not limited to, the following: Work with and obtain a broad knowledge of non-metallic materials and their related fabrication processes. Evaluate and qualify new materials for incorporation into design requirements and production operation. Support obsolescence and continuous improvement efforts. Participate in material review of discrepant material, work to identify root cause and develop preventative/corrective action. Write, modify and release updates to PMP documentation (e.g. material specification and detailed process instructions). Support testing efforts including engineering test plans, procedural development, and production acceptance testing.
